Content Everywhere OTT & Streaming Highlights
A unique feature of the IBC show is the Content Everywhere programme: a free-to-attend programme of panel discussions and product demonstrations devised to help IBC visitors explore different aspects of the delivery and consumption of content, covering everything from Multi-Platform Delivery, OTT equipment & services, Personalisation and Streaming to Cloud Services, Advertising Tech, App Development, CDNs, Cyber Security and IPTV.
Themes such as streaming, monetisation, cloud, artificial intelligence, and sustainability will be recurring themes throughout the programme and each will also be addressed by dedicated panels. 2024 OTT & Streaming Accelerator Projects
ECOFLOW: Energy-Conserving Optimization for Future-ready, Low-impact Online Workflows will tackle the environmental impact of media consumption by developing consolidated metrics for energy consumption at major steps of the end-to-end technology supply chain, best-of-breed energy-saving features into a unified user experience.
The aim of the Scalable Ultra-Low Latency Streaming for Premium Sports is to achieve Twitter/X-equivalent latency and a near-instant playback start using standard existing HTTP streaming technical stack and infrastructure.
Connecting Live Performances of the Future with ULL-AVLM (Ultra-Low Latency Audio, Video, Light and Media Data) will also aim to recreate the experience of a live performance in multiple locations or bring together remote performers into a seamless and immersive live experience.
